§ 40:55D-68 — 5 "Senior citizen" defined.

2.For the purposes of this act, a "senior citizen" is any person who has attained the age of 62 years on or after the effective date of this act, or the spouse of that person, or the surviving spouse of that person, if the surviving spouse is 55 years of age or older. L.1997,c.339,s.2.
